The Scrum Master will lead the CMM Data Modernization and Governance agile practice and team in delivering an integrated data governance engineering data platform reporting analytics and Artificial Intelligence (AI)/Machine Learning (ML) capabilities that support operational decision-making and advance AO's data and analytics objectives in support of the CMM program. The successful candidate will be an experienced scrum master with a long track record of successfully enabling agile teams and facilitating delivery in complex environments. The Scrum Master is responsible for coaching the team removing impediments fostering strong customer and stakeholder collaboration and ensuring consistent delivery through agile processes and continuous improvement.

This individual will help the teams reach higher levels of agility performance and operational maturity. THE SCRUM MASTER WILL EXECUTE THE FOLLOWING
Establish clear team goals and iteration plans that align with Program Increment (PI) objectives for the CMM Data Modernization and Governance program. Coach technical teams and Product Owners on Agile concepts frameworks and practices including Epic and User Story creation SAFe Scrum and Kanban to strengthen agile execution. Manage expectations and support collaboration across multiple Product Owners (POs). Engage with clients and senior leadership to ensure transparency alignment and effective communication. Provide leadership across major workstreams and guide teams through complex data modernization tasks. Facilitate cross-team communication to identify dependencies risks and impediments that may impact delivery develop and support mitigation strategies. Organize and lead all Scrum ceremonies including daily standups Sprint Planning and Backlog Grooming Sprint Reviews/Demos and Retrospectives. Maintain JIRA boards and other information radiators to ensure accurate and timely visibility into team progress. Mentor and coach teams on core Agile values principles and practices to foster continuous learning and improvement. Enable teams to become self‑organizing self‑managing and accountable for achieving sprint and release goals. Partner with Product Management to prepare release plans and support backlog grooming prioritization and stakeholder visibility. Motivate and support teams in delivering high‑quality work across analysis development testing documentation and other critical activities. Identify communicate and help resolve project risks dependencies and team impediments. Ensure the team’s Definition of Done is clearly established and consistently applied across stories sprints and releases. Promote collaborative decision‑making and facilitate conflict resolution to maintain team productivity. Protect the team from external disruptions and unplanned work that threaten sprint commitments. Support internal and external communication to enhance transparency across the CMM program. Foster a trusting safe team environment where issues can be raised early and addressed constructively. Assess Scrum maturity and coach teams toward higher levels of agile proficiency at a sustainable pace. Champion a continuous improvement mindset and recommend adjustments to enhance delivery practices. Participate in Scrum‑of‑Scrums to coordinate cross‑team dependencies integration activities and release plans. Build strong relationships with stakeholders including customers technical teams and leadership to support successful delivery. Provide biweekly Agile reports such as sprint reports backlog reporting sprint burndown charts sprint retrospective reports risk registry etc. Develop and update the Risks Assumptions Issues and Dependencies (RAID) log and other project management related artifacts. Perform risk identification and mitigation. Identify and communicate technical operational and business risks develop mitigation strategies. Provide transparent reporting with regular updates to stakeholders on progress risks financials and outcomes. Provide the COR and government leads with analysis and research of alternatives and solution and design options related to the Case Management Modernization effort upon request. QUALIFICATIONS Education Technical Training Certification(s) or Degree required BA or BS degree strongly preferred. Experience 5+ years of experience in an Agile development environment required. Project Management Professional Certification (PMP) required. Certified Scrum Master (CSM) -or- Agile Certified Practitioner (PMI-ACP) required. SAFe Agilist Certification (SA) required. Experience with using and implementing the Scaled Agile Framework (SAFe) Scrum and KanBan. Ability to manage multiple projects and work rapidly in a high tempo environment that often requires multitasking. Experience with software development data governance or working in an analytics organization. Ability to create sustain and enhance fostering team dynamics and collaboration. Expertise in overseeing teams dedicated to big data cloud solution architecture cybersecurity data management business intelligence and analytics. Excellent customer-facing skills with experience briefing senior executive leadership. Security Clearance Level Must be able to pass a background check to obtain a position of Public Trust. Must be a US Person (Green Card Holder US Permanent Resident Alien Refugee Asylee or US Citizen).
